![]() Since surrendering the top spot to London in 2012, New York has remained at second place. As it geared up for the 2012 Olympic and Paralympic Games and other major cultural and sporting events, London greatly improved its overall magnetism. On the other hand, air quality in several of the cities mentioned has deteriorated – albeit not in Vancouver, which came in third for having the lowest PM2.5 concentration.London has maintained the top position since 2012, falling within the top three for all functions other than Livability and Environment. For one thing, most cities in the ranking had a lower GDP Growth Rate than the previous year. As a result, both positive and negative shifts in urban power have been seen by the GPCI. According to the 2022 Index, Vancouver ranks 34th globally and second in Canada, trailing only Toronto.Īccording to the 2022 report, two years have elapsed since the epidemic began, which indicates that socioeconomic activity and travel are beginning to return in many places throughout the world. The rating takes into account six major factors: economy, R&D, cultural interaction, livability, environment, and accessibility. ![]() The Global Capacity City Index evaluates the world’s biggest cities each year based on “their complete power to attract people, capital, and companies from all over the world.” While Vancouver may not be at the top of the lists or be considered an economic powerhouse, it is developing as a leader in numerous crucial areas.
